Understanding the Marketing Funnel
A clear understanding of the marketing funnel is essential for financial advisors. The funnel consists of three layers: top, middle, and bottom, each serving a different purpose. Top of funnel activities include tactics like SEO and paid advertising to build brand awareness without directly converting prospects into clients. The middle section aims to nurture leads by building trust and demonstrating expertise, while the bottom of the funnel is where the final sales process occurs, guiding potential clients to make a decision.
Maximizing Impact Through Educational Exposure
Leveraging established platforms for educational outreach emerges as a highly effective marketing strategy. By guesting on podcasts, writing for blogs, or participating in webinars, advisors can reach their ideal clients quickly and efficiently, bypassing the prolonged process of building their own audience. This approach not only drives visibility but also allows advisors to showcase their expertise and provide a clear call to action. The strategy is further validated through examples of successful client conversions that originated from a single guest appearance.
Strategies for Building Relationships and Success
Building relationships with platform owners can enhance the success of marketing strategies based on guest appearances. Advisors should focus on establishing a clear message and a specific call to action while providing valuable content to the audience. Efforts to network effectively—whether through existing connections or cold outreach—can significantly shorten the time needed to gain access to ideal client audiences. Investing in this relational approach, despite its challenges, can lead to profound impacts on business growth and client acquisition.
